Output ba59c1a1fdd2afb7606692449020559fa1c3fe7836ff40816f364e28c89ab5ee:3

value
621267
script pubkey
OP_0 OP_PUSHBYTES_20 b050b08594ea8d79b9f6a4bb63a95a690c122510
address
bc1qkpgtppv5a2xhnw0k5jak8226dyxpyfgsqu64de
transaction
ba59c1a1fdd2afb7606692449020559fa1c3fe7836ff40816f364e28c89ab5ee